How Is Compensation for a Baton Rouge Burn Injury Settlement Calculated?

Every year, there are thousands injured in burn accidents across Louisiana. These burn injuries can cost victims and their families hundreds of thousands of dollars in medical treatments and surgeries. Baton Rouge, a major urban hub, makes up a significant portion of state burn injury statistics every year. If you are suffering a burn injury in Baton Rouge, you may be eligible to seek a financial settlement for your losses with the help of a burn injury lawyer.

You may be asking: how is compensation for a Baton Rouge burn injury settlement calculated? Using our decades of experience in personal injury law, the Louisiana lawyers at Carabin Shaw ask the following questions to calculate an estimated settlement amount.

What Is the Extent of the Burn Injury?

Burn injuries are categorized by degrees of severity. The amount of your financial settlement is usually directly related to the severity of your burns. However, this does not mean that you should not seek fair compensation for superficial burns caused by the negligence of others.

A first-degree burn is the least severe type of burn injury and is characterized by:

  • Damage not reaching beyond the first layer of skin (epidermis)
  • Redness and irritation
  • Typically can be treated at home

Second-degree burns, however, begin to look far more serious. Second-degree burns are characterized by:

  • Damage of both layers of skin (epidermis and dermis)
  • Blistering of the affected area
  • Swollen and painful skin

Third-degree burns are the most severe by far and will more likely than not require hospitalization. Third-degree burns are characterized by:

  • Damage to the epidermis, dermis, and layers of fat and muscle beneath
  • Extensive scarring
  • Damaged nerves and joints
  • Loss of consciousness
  • Hyperthermia
What Medical Treatments Did the Patient Require?

Second- and third-degree burn victims often require extensive, costly procedures to treat their injuries. For example, skin-grafting, a procedure in which healthy tissue from one part of the body is grafted onto damaged tissues surrounding the burn, can cost an average of $18,000.

It is important to keep careful documentation of all of your medical treatments and procedures so that your Baton Rouge personal injury lawyer can claim the full extent of your damages in your burn injury lawsuit.

Can Emotional Damages be Claimed?

The reality is that the longest lasting damages after a severe burn accident are the emotional pain and suffering faced by victims and their families. Victims may face disfiguring injuries that affect their quality of life. Complications resulting from severe burns may permanently impact mobility. Families may grieve for their loved ones lost in house fires or workplace explosions. An experienced burn injury attorney will fight for their client’s right to compensation for their emotional trauma.

Was the Accident Caused by Gross Negligence or Ill Intent?

Legally, gross negligence is considered a reckless disregard for safety and an enormous breach of responsibility. A defendant can be considered to be acting with ill-intent if they purposefully cause harm. If your burn injuries were caused by the defendant’s gross negligence or ill-intent, you may be able to claim punitive damages in addition to the above physical, financial, and emotional damages.
